Esophageal varices are dilated, tortuous veins which are found mainly in the submucosa of the lower esophagus but which may also appear higher up or extend into the stomach. They develop due to increased pressure in the portal venous system, often as a result of liver cirrhosis. This condition scars and damages the liver, impeding normal blood flow through the portal vein. Secondary prophylaxis for esophageal variceal bleeding.

Agustín Albillos1, Marta Tejedor2

  • 1Department of Gastroenterology and Hepatology, Hospital Universitario Ramón y Cajal, CIBERehd, IRYCIS, University of Alcalá, Ctra. Colmenar km. 9.100, Madrid 28034, Spain.

Clinics in Liver Disease
|April 1, 2014
PubMed
Summary

Combination therapy using beta-blockers and endoscopic band ligation (EBL) effectively prevents esophageal variceal rebleeding in cirrhosis. Beta-blockers are crucial, offering broader benefits beyond variceal bleeding prevention.

Area of Science:

  • Hepatology
  • Gastroenterology
  • Clinical Medicine

Background:

  • Esophageal variceal rebleeding is a major complication of cirrhosis and portal hypertension.
  • Combination therapy with beta-blockers and endoscopic band ligation (EBL) is the standard prophylactic approach.
  • Beta-blockers offer systemic benefits for portal hypertension complications beyond variceal bleeding.

Purpose of the Study:

  • To evaluate the efficacy of combination therapy for esophageal variceal rebleeding prophylaxis.
  • To elucidate the role of beta-blockers and EBL in preventing rebleeding.
  • To identify patient subgroups that may benefit from alternative or earlier interventions like transjugular intrahepatic portosystemic shunt (TIPS).

Main Methods:

  • The study reviews existing data on combination therapy for esophageal variceal rebleeding.
  • Analysis focuses on the additive benefits of beta-blockers to EBL versus EBL to beta-blockers.
  • Consideration of transjugular intrahepatic portosystemic shunt (TIPS) as a rescue or alternative first-line therapy.

Main Results:

  • Combination therapy with beta-blockers and EBL significantly reduces esophageal variceal rebleeding.
  • The addition of beta-blockers to EBL is more effective than adding EBL to beta-blockers, due to EBL's risk of post-banding ulcer bleeding.
  • Transjugular intrahepatic portosystemic shunt (TIPS) is effective as a rescue treatment.

Conclusions:

  • Combination therapy is the standard for preventing esophageal variceal rebleeding.
  • Beta-blockers are the cornerstone of this therapy due to their wide-ranging benefits in portal hypertension.
  • TIPS should be considered for specific patient groups, including those with refractory ascites or fundal varices, or those who bleed initially despite beta-blocker therapy.
